Abstract:
As increased human activity and its effects, the availability of clean drinking water has
become a scarce and valuable, requiring often an assessment to identify its quality for its
various uses. Thus, this study aims to evaluate the quality of groundwater sources region of
Juazeiro Municipality - EC, coming from the wells operated by CAGECE in the river basin
Salgado, under the physical-chemical aspects, concerning the variation space / time and the
limits established by Decree 2914/11 the Ministry of Health. The data of the parameters for
the periods of May and November 2013, May and November 2014, regarding the company's
heritage of 33 wells CAGECE, for a total of 124 samples, divided between the four periods.
The results were submitted to the Piper diagram for further classification and comparison of
different water groups as the dominant ions. In general, the groundwater were classified as
mixed bicarbonated water. In function of time, using the Tukey test were observed
interference level of 5% probability in pH, magnesium, and aluminum fluoride. As for the
spatial factor, there is significant variation in the level of 5% probability the parameters pH,
alkalinity, hardness, calcium, chloride, iron, STD and CE. Levels of 1% and 0.1%
significance level were detected in all wells with the nitrate by the Tukey test. According to
the Ordinance 2914/11 MS, it was confirmed that some wells showed indices related to
certain parameters above the tolerable water potability, during the four monitored periods.
The city's water is of good quality in terms of drinkability, however some areas may have
been contaminated by human actions, in this way, it is necessary monitoring to verify the
occurrence of this fact observed mainly by nitrates parameter.
